Airjet

Airjet can weave multi-colored yarns to make plaids and are available with both dobby and jacquard patterning mechanism

Air jet weaving is a high-speed fabric manufacturing method that uses compressed air to insert the weft yarn across the warp. The core equipment, known as the air jet loom, is valued for its speed, efficiency, and ability to produce uniform fabrics.

The technology relies on advanced air jet filling insertion, where yarn is propelled through the shed by air nozzles. Modern systems include the air jet loom machine designed as a high velocity air jet loom to achieve superior productivity with consistent fabric quality.

Based on design capability, air jet looms are categorized into dobby air jet loom for simple patterns, jacquard air jet loom for complex designs, and multi color air jet loom for decorative and technical textiles. These looms are widely used for apparel, home textiles, and industrial fabrics.
